"Día de las Sopas Perotas" (Day of Perotas Soups) in Álora is celebrated every first Saturday of October, and in 2025, the date will be Saturday, October 4, 2025. On that day 1000s of visitors will flock to the town to enjoy this local dish, which has its origins in the 19th century when the local Field workers and Farmers, used whatever they had to hand to provide a substantial meal for their families. The local economy was based of agriculture and workers made the best of what they had to create this dish, stale bread, potatoes, tomatoes and Olive Oil. Over the years it has been enhanced with the addition of Onions, green peppers, olives and asparagus, to create both a filling and tasty meal.
The event is held in the Plaza de la Despedía (PLaza Baja) with the magnificent Parish Church providing a back drop to the traditional folk dancing, Flamenco, and of course, music as well as stalls to browse whilst you enjoy this unique dish.
It forms part of the Andalucian Calendar of Events and is one of the highlights of year.
